After announcing that her marriage to Jamie Bell was ending, Evan Rachel Wood went on a self-imposed Twitter hiatus. The star's absence from the social networking site didn't last long, however.

"Looks like someone is already trying to start a rumor that I 'hooked up' with Michelle Rodriguez at 'an evening with women,'" the actress, 26, tweeted Friday. "I have never even said 'hello' to Michelle Rodriguez. I think it's convenient someone chose to make up the story now and not that night."

Sharing a video from the May 10 event, she tweeted, "If 'a source' saw us leave together, why am I seen here leaving alone?" Wood continued to vent, tweeting, "This is 'journalism' at its lowest. Complete lies made up to exploit a public separation, as if that isn't hard enough. Disgusting. Also just because you are in a photo with someone doesn't mean you spoke or slept together. Really guys?"

Wood then announced she was going back to her "Twitter break" before retweeting a number of fans.

Rodriguez, who like Wood is also bisexual, has yet to do her own damage control via social media.

After 19 months of marriage, Wood and Bell announced their separation Wednesday. "They both love and respect one another and will of course remain committed to co-parenting their son," the famous exes' rep told E! News in a statement. "This is a mutual decision and the two remain close friends."
